“While Fair Rent Commissions in Connecticut have existed since the 1960s, the rental and job market difficulties of the COVID-19 pandemic led to the state legislature expanding the Commissions’ power in recent years.”

The Connecticut Supreme Court ruled an eviction could not proceed if the tenant has a pending case with the local Fair Rent Commission, which helps mediate rent increases and investigate general rental cost complaints filed by tenants.

Did you know that landlords in the Oklahoma City area file roughly the same number of evictions as the entire state of Connecticut? In 2025, landlords filed more than 16,000 evictions in Oklahoma County. That is 12 eviction filings for every 100 renter households.

In partnership with Mental Health Association Oklahoma , we have added Oklahoma City to our Eviction Tracking System — now offering data for more than 10 states and over 40 cities.
